The Huronia Nurse Practitioner-Led Clinic is funded by the Ontario Ministry of Health and Long Term Care. It
is governed by a volunteer Board of
Directors. We are located northeast of Barrie in the rolling hills of
the Horseshoe Valley in the Township of Oro-Medonte.
The Huronia Nurse Practitioner-Led Clinic provides primary health care services and preventive care to people of all ages. Whether
you need to have a complete physical or need to visit us with a minor
illness or to manage a chronic or complex illness, the clinic is here
for you or your family.
We
are staffed by two Primary Health Care Nurse Practitioners, a part-time Pharmacist, an
Administrative Lead and an Administrative Support staff. We have off-site collaborating physician partners. We work together as a team of professionals to meet your health care needs and goals. We are a growing clinic. We are expanding our current premises over the course of the year and we will be adding more clinical and administrative staff along the way.
Nurse
Practitioners are nurses that have additional education and licencing
to provide primary health care to individuals and families. They can do
complete physical examinations, order diagnostic tests like
ultrasounds, X-rays or mammograms, order bloodwork to screen for illness
or disease, diagnose illness and disease and prescribe medications
necessary for you. When care is beyond the Nurse Practitioner's scope
to manage, a physician is consulted. If necessary, you will be seen by
both the Nurse Practitioner and the visiting physician. For more information about Nurse Practitioners visit http://www.npao.org
